Origins and Meaning

The surname Wisla is of Slavic origin and is believed to be derived from the name of the Vistula River, which is the longest river in Poland. The Vistula River, known as Wisła in Polish, has been an important waterway in Central Europe for centuries and has played a significant role in the history and culture of the region. It is likely that the surname Wisla was originally used to denote someone who lived near the Vistula River or who came from a place with that name.

Poland

Interestingly, the surname Wisla has a relatively low incidence in Poland, with only 7 occurrences reported. This may be due to the fact that the name Wisła is a common geographical name in Poland, and individuals with this surname may be more likely to use variations or alternative spellings.
